Newly delivered 76m Feadship superyacht One sold

16 May 2025 • Written by Nick Jeffery and Dea Jusufi

The recently delivered 75.8-metre Feadship superyacht One has been sold with Arjen van Elk of Feadship Resale and Burgess, who acted as the buying broker.

A brand-new build, the handsome blue and white exterior profile is penned by Studio De Voogt with naval architecture by Azure Naval Architects and interior by Gilles & Boissier of Paris. The yacht was co-listed with Tomaso Polli and Hannah Wolstenholme of Edmiston.

One was last asking €172,500,000

One accommodates a party of 12 and features two equally impressive master staterooms – one on the dedicated owner's deck, the other full-beam suite on the main deck – as well as four lower deck guest cabins with step-free access to the beach club that opens up to port and starboard. There are quarters for a crew of 18.

An elevator serves the main deck, owner's deck and bridge deck. There are Jacuzzis positioned on the owner's deck forward and the bridge deck aft. In the bridge deck wellness centre, guests can enjoy panoramic views from an aft-facing, glass-walled gym which opens on three sides.

Distinctive herringbone teak decking is a first for the yard, extending to the foredeck which doubles as a "touch and go" helipad.

A glass-bottomed pool on the main deck allows daylight to filter through to the beach club below – wellness is the theme with a sauna and massage room also included in the design.

The yacht had its technical launch in 2023

The 1750GT yacht has a range of 5,000 nautical miles at its cruising speed of 12 knots, under twin 2,001hp MTU diesels. Maximum speed is 15.4 knots.
